A beds topper (sometimes called a mattress topper) is a layer of cushioning material placed on top of your mattress to improve comfort, support and sleep quality. In simple terms, it’s a soft or supportive layer you add on top of your existing bed to make it feel plusher, cooler or more supportive—without replacing your mattress entirely. Beds toppers can transform an old mattress, tailor firmness to your preference, and enhance your bedroom’s overall comfort and style.

Types & styles of beds toppers available in Australia
Beds toppers come in many materials, thicknesses and constructions to suit different sleepers, climates and budgets.
Memory foam beds toppers
Memory foam moulds to your body, relieving pressure points and providing contouring comfort—ideal for side sleepers or anyone needing extra cushion.
Latex beds toppers
Natural or synthetic latex offers buoyant, responsive support with a cooler feel than traditional memory foam. Great for back or combination sleepers.
Feather & down beds toppers
Luxurious and cloud-like, these toppers add plush softness and warmth. They’re excellent for lighter sleepers and those who prefer a traditional “pillowy” feel.
Wool beds toppers
Wool regulates temperature naturally, keeping you warm in winter and cool in summer—a perfect choice for Australian seasonal shifts.
Gel-infused foam toppers
With gel beads or layers, these toppers help dissipate heat, making them ideal for hot sleepers or warm climates across Australia.
Pillow-top style beds toppers
These have sewn-on cushioning layers that mimic hotel-style plushness and add visible loft to your bed.
Hybrid beds toppers
Combining foam, fibres and latex, hybrids balance support, softness and breathability for all-round performance.
Cooling & breathable options
Designed with perforations, airflow channels or moisture-wicking covers to keep you cool in humid or warm Australian conditions.
How to choose the right beds topper (Australia-focused)
Here’s why it’s important to choose well: the right beds topper improves sleep quality, supports your body and complements your mattress—making bedtime feel intentional rather than ordinary.
1. Know your sleep preference
Do you want softer comfort, firmer support, or temperature regulation? Side sleepers often prefer plush options, while back or stomach sleepers benefit from more support.
2. Consider thickness
Beds toppers typically range from 3 cm to 10 cm+. Thicker toppers add more cushioning but may change support levels—balance softness with spinal alignment.
3. Choose the right material
Memory foam for pressure relief, latex for responsiveness, wool for temperature control, feathers for plushness—your pick depends on comfort priorities.
4. Think about heat management
If you sleep hot (common in warm Australian summers), look for cooling gels, breathable covers and materials that don’t trap heat.
5. Match mattress size
Ensure your beds topper matches your mattress dimensions (single, double, queen, king) for a seamless fit.
6. Evaluate firmness preferences
Soft toppers create a cosy “hugging” feel; medium options balance support and cushion; firmer toppers enhance spinal alignment.
7. Check maintenance needs
Removable, washable covers help keep your topper fresh and allergen-free.

Benefits & use cases of beds toppers
A beds topper does more than just add softness—it can transform your entire sleep experience.
Improve comfort without replacing your mattress
If your mattress feels too firm, sagging or uncomfortable, a beds topper gives you an instant feel upgrade without the cost of a new bed.
Pressure relief
Memory foam and latex toppers ease pressure on hips, shoulders and lower back—beneficial for aching joints or chronic pain.
Enhance temperature regulation
Wool, gel-infused and breathable toppers help manage heat and moisture—perfect for different Australian climates.
Extend mattress life
Adding a beds topper protects the mattress surface, reducing wear and prolonging usability.
Better sleep routine
A personalised sleep surface helps you fall asleep faster and stay asleep longer—boosting overall rest quality.
Guest comfort
A topper can instantly upgrade a guest bed, making stays more comfortable and welcoming.
In Australian homes, beds toppers are especially popular in coastal regions (for cooling comfort), cooler states (for warmth with wool or feather options) and family homes where mattresses see heavy use.

Common beds topper questions (AEO-friendly)
How thick should a beds topper be?
Most beds toppers range from 3 cm to 10 cm or more. Thicker options add more plushness, while thinner ones offer subtle comfort.
Can a beds topper fix a sagging mattress?
A beds topper can improve comfort and support but won’t fully correct structural sagging. For deep dips, a mattress replacement may be necessary.
Are beds toppers good for back pain?
Yes—especially memory foam or latex toppers that relieve pressure and support spinal alignment.
How do I care for my beds topper?
Use a removable, washable cover and follow care instructions. Rotate or air out regularly to maintain freshness.
